A member asked:

How can you treat internal hemroids? should treatment be immediate due to precautions?

A doctor has provided 1 answer
Dr. Paul Batty answered

Specializes in General Surgery

Treatment: conservative measures may be indicated initially with stool softeners and a high fiber diet. if you have bleeding then colonoscopy should be done for completion. do not assume bleeding is just from hemorrhoids. There are several treatment options which include banding, infrared light and circular stapled hemorrhoidectomy with proctopexy as well as standard surgical hemorrhoidectomy
